Transavia to launch Brussels–Ponta Delgada route in 2027

Transavia is adding a new route from Brussels to Ponta Delgada in the Azores starting summer 2027, part of a wider expansion of its Brussels network.

Transavia plans a new route between Brussels and Ponta Delgada in the Azores from summer 2027, the airline said. Tickets are expected to go on sale from September 16, though the carrier hasn't yet confirmed a start date or flight frequency.

The Air France-KLM budget subsidiary is also adding Heraklion and Thessaloniki to its Brussels network as part of the same expansion. Portugal is becoming a growing focus for the airline out of Brussels in particular.

Transavia already flies between Brussels and Faro. It's set to begin a three-times-weekly service to Porto on December 14, according to the airline's announcement. The carrier has also increased its aircraft presence at Brussels, now basing four aircraft there, up from previous levels.

No further details on pricing or scheduling for the Ponta Delgada route have been released.
